Zmena panelov – JavaScript, AJAX, jQuery – Fórum – Programujte.com
 x   TIP: Přetáhni ikonu na hlavní panel pro připnutí webu
Reklama
Reklama

Zmena panelov – JavaScript, AJAX, jQuery – Fórum – Programujte.comZmena panelov – JavaScript, AJAX, jQuery – Fórum – Programujte.com

 

Hledá se programátor! Plat 1 800 € + bonusy (firma Boxmol.com)
16. 5. 2007   #1
-
0
-

mám nasledujúci kód, ktorý používam na zmenu panelov v menu:

<html>

<head></head>
<body>
<script>
preloadm2 = new Image();
preloadm2.src = "../../file/web/buttons/m2-over.jpg";

preloadrtw = new Image();
preloadrtw.src = "../../file/web/buttons/rtw-over.jpg";

preloadmtw = new Image();
preloadmtw.src = "../../file/web/buttons/mtw-over.jpg";

preloadstw = new Image();
preloadstw.src = "../../file/web/buttons/stw-over.jpg";

preloadforum = new Image();
preloadforum.src = "../../file/web/buttons/forum-over.jpg";

m2 = "../../file/web/buttons/m2.jpg";
rtw = "../../file/web/buttons/rtw.jpg";
mtw = "../../file/web/buttons/mtw.jpg";
stw = "../../file/web/buttons/stw.jpg";
forum = "../../file/web/buttons/forum.jpg";

</script>

<div><img src="../../file/web/buttons/m2.jpg" onmouseover="this.src=preloadm2.src" onmouseout="this.src=m2" onclick="document.getElementById('m2').style.display='block';document.getElementById('rtw').style.display='none';document.getElementById('rtr').style.display='none';document.getElementById('mtw').style.display='none';document.getElementById('stw').style.display='none';" style="cursor:hand; border-top-width:2px; border-left-width:2px; border-right-width:2px; border-bottom-width:0px; border-color:#000000; border-style:solid"></div>
<div><img src="../../file/web/buttons/rtw.jpg" onmouseover="this.src=preloadrtw.src" onmouseout="this.src=rtw" onclick="document.getElementById('m2').style.display='none';document.getElementById('rtw').style.display='block';document.getElementById('rtr').style.display='block';document.getElementById('mtw').style.display='none';document.getElementById('stw').style.display='none';" style="cursor:hand; border-top-width:2px; border-left-width:2px; border-right-width:2px; border-bottom-width:0px; border-color:#000000; border-style:solid"></div>
<div><img src="../../file/web/buttons/mtw.jpg" onmouseover="this.src=preloadmtw.src" onmouseout="this.src=mtw" onclick="document.getElementById('m2').style.display='none';document.getElementById('rtw').style.display='none';document.getElementById('rtr').style.display='none';document.getElementById('mtw').style.display='block';document.getElementById('stw').style.display='none';" style="cursor:hand; border-top-width:2px; border-left-width:2px; border-right-width:2px; border-bottom-width:0px; border-color:#000000; border-style:solid"></div>
<div><img src="../../file/web/buttons/stw.jpg" onmouseover="this.src=preloadstw.src" onmouseout="this.src=stw" onclick="document.getElementById('m2').style.display='none';document.getElementById('rtw').style.display='none';document.getElementById('rtr').style.display='none';document.getElementById('mtw').style.display='none';document.getElementById('stw').style.display='block';" style="cursor:hand; border-top-width:2px; border-left-width:2px; border-right-width:2px; border-bottom-width:0px; border-color:#000000; border-style:solid"></div>
<div><a href="http://totalwar.herniweb.cz/forum" target="_blank"><img src="../../file/web/buttons/forum.jpg" onmouseover="this.src=preloadforum.src" onmouseout="this.src=forum" style="cursor:hand; border-top-width:2px; border-left-width:2px; border-right-width:2px; border-bottom-width:2px; border-color:#000000; border-style:solid"></a></div>
</body>
</html>


ten includujem do theme.php (pouzivam redakcny system), k headeru. problemom vsak je, ze ked si niekto zmeni panel a klikne na nejaky odkaz, tak sa mu nacita ten prednastaveny panel, cize si ho potom musi znova zmenit. neviem, ci som to vysvetlil dobre a zrozumitelne, mozete si to [url=http://totalwar.herniweb.cz]prezriet tu[/url].

nie je nejaky sposob, ako to "osetrit"? aby si prehliadac zapamatal, ktory panel mal otvoreny.

Nahlásit jako SPAM
IP: ...–
http://totalwar.herniweb.cz http://herniweb.cz
Reklama
Reklama
Marek Štafl0
Stálý člen
28. 5. 2007   #2
-
0
-

Cookie nebo session. Spíš cookie v JavaScriptu.

Nahlásit jako SPAM
IP: ...–
Zjistit počet nových příspěvků

Přidej příspěvek

Toto téma je starší jak čtvrt roku – přidej svůj příspěvek jen tehdy, máš-li k tématu opravdu co říct!

Ano, opravdu chci reagovat → zobrazí formulář pro přidání příspěvku

×Vložení zdrojáku

×Vložení obrázku

Vložit URL obrázku Vybrat obrázek na disku
Vlož URL adresu obrázku:
Klikni a vyber obrázek z počítače:

×Vložení videa

Aktuálně jsou podporována videa ze serverů YouTube, Vimeo a Dailymotion.
×
 
Podporujeme Gravatara.
Zadej URL adresu Avatara (40 x 40 px) nebo emailovou adresu pro použití Gravatara.
Email nikam neukládáme, po získání Gravatara je zahozen.
-
Pravidla pro psaní příspěvků, používej diakritiku. ENTER pro nový odstavec, SHIFT + ENTER pro nový řádek.
Sledovat nové příspěvky (pouze pro přihlášené)
Sleduj vlákno a v případě přidání nového příspěvku o tom budeš vědět mezi prvními.
Reaguješ na příspěvek:

Uživatelé prohlížející si toto vlákno

Uživatelé on-line: 0 registrovaných, 15 hostů

Podobná vlákna

Změna IP — založil don_Dominique

Zmena pismena — založil Onsi

Změna barvy — založil Lenka

Změna barev — založil Lukáš

Zmena domény — založil Thomas9

 

Hostujeme u Českého hostingu       ISSN 1801-1586       ⇡ Nahoru Webtea.cz logo © 20032016 Programujte.com
Zasadilo a pěstuje Webtea.cz, šéfredaktor Lukáš Churý